microMPEG4-D4 – 4 Channel, Full Frame Rate MPEG-4 Codec for mini PCI

microMPEG4-D4 - 4-x канальный кодек MPEG-4 / G.723  в формате mini PCI,  -40º ~ +85º C

The microMPEG4-D4 is a 4 channel, full frame rate MPEG-4 Codec on a single Type-III mini PCI module. The microMPEG4-D4 provides a powerful solution for capturing and compressing analog video inputs to the MPEG-4 standard. The microMPEG4-D4 not only provides MPEG-4 compression but can also simultaneously decompress and replay recordings from storage to display.

The microMPEG4-D4 allows high quality real-time video and audio capture and compression from NTSC/PAL video sources to disk and simultaneously provides an additional path for uncompressed video for on-screen preview or optional downstream video analytics.

Highlights

Quad speed MPEG4 video codec
Up to 4 x 4CIF (704 x576) size encoding at full frame rate (for NTSC / RS-170, PAL / CCIR video signals)
MPEG4 decode playback
Composite video or s-video outputs for preview or playback
High speed text overlay (for recording path)
High speed bit mapped graphics overlay with multi-level alpha blending (for analog preview output)
Automatic detection of motion
G.723 audio codec for each input channel with single audio playback channel
Real-time video preview to system VGA or NTSC/PAL output
Drivers for Windows XP/XP-Embedded and Linux
Low power Type IIIB mini PCI form factor
Operating temperature: 0°C to +60°C or -40°C to +85°C
Software Development Kits

The microMPEG4-D4 is supported by comprehensive and well supported software development kits (SDKs) for video recording and video streaming. The SDKs are designed to significantly reduce development time in Windows and Linux environments and include support libraries, drivers and example applications to help developers fully utilize the microMPEG4-D4 features in complex video compression / overlay applications.

The standard Video Recording SDK and sample applications are supplied free of charge with each board and includes the services of our technical support team. The Video Streaming SDK is available for a one-time fee and enables real time streaming of compressed video data over an IP network.

The standard SDKs are available for x86 based embedded PC platforms however, we also offer SDKs suitable for mini PCI based ARM and PowerPC platforms. Please contact our sales team to discuss your requirements.

mini PCI Bus Interface
Type III miniPCI
132MBytes/sec bandwidth at 33.33 MHz bus speed
Live multi-stream MPEG-4 capture to memory or disk
Concurrent MPEG-4 Capture and live preview

Analog Video Input
Up to 4 concurrent composite PAL or NTSC video input channels
Four 10-bit Analog-to-Digital converters
Anti-aliasing filters on inputs

Video Input Formats
Standard CCIR601-NTSC, CCIR-PAL
NTSC-M, NTSC-N, NTSC-J, NTSC (4.43), RS-170
PAL-B,G,N, PAL-D, PAL-H, PAL-I, PAL-M, PAL-NC, PAL-60

Video Input Adjustments
Contrast (or luma gain) adjustable from 0 - 200% of original
Saturation (or chroma gain) adjustable from 0 - 200% of original
Hue (or chroma phase) adjustable from –180° to +180°
Brightness (or luma level) can be adjusted from –25 to +25 IRE
Software adjustable Sharpness, Gamma and noise suppression

Audio Input
4x mono input
Provides Audio/Video Synchronisation

Video Encoding
ISO/IEC 14496-2, MPEG-4 SOP at Level 3
M-JPEG Video Encoding (optional)
4 channel NTSC 4CIF ( 704 x 480) at 30fps
4 channel PAL 4CIF ( 704 x 576) at 25fps
Supports I and P Frame Compression
Supports Variable Bit Rate (VBR)
Supports Constant Bit Rate (CBR)

Audio Encoding
G.723 Audio Codec

Video Decoding / Playback
Real-time MPEG-4 Video Decoding
Playback to Composite PAL/NTSC output (optional)
Uncompressed Video Path
Real-time Preview to host VGA display
Preview to Composite PAL/NTSC output (optional)
Optional uncompressed RGB/YUV for downstream applications

Motion Detection
330 (NTSC) or 396 (PAL) detection blocks
Masking of areas not required for motion detection
Adjustable sensitivity

System Requirements
x86 PC-Compatible Host Computer with spare miniPCI type III slot
PCI/AGP Display (if Video Preview to host is required)

Miscellaneous
Standard mini PCI form factor
Operating temp 0°C to 60°C
Operating temp –40°C to +85°C (extended temp option)

Software Drivers
Drivers for WindowsXP and Linux
Sample video recording application in C/C++ source code
